Foundation jacking services involve the process of stabilizing and leveling a building’s foundation that has shifted or settled over time. This technique typically uses hydraulic jacks and support systems to lift and reinforce the existing foundation, restoring it to its proper position. The goal is to address uneven settling, cracks, or other structural issues that can compromise the integrity of a property. By carefully lifting and supporting the foundation, specialists help prevent further damage and improve the safety and stability of the structure.
Many property owners turn to foundation jacking services to resolve problems caused by ground movement, soil erosion, or poor initial construction. Common signs indicating the need for foundation jacking include u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ation or exterior walls. Addressing these issues early with professional foundation jacking can help mitigate more extensive and costly repairs in the future, preserving the property's value and safety.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Cost of Foundation Jacking - Typically ranges from $3,000 to $15,000 depending on the extent of the work and the size of the structure. Larger or more complex projects tend to be on the higher end of the spectrum.
Factors Affecting Pricing - Costs can vary based on soil conditions, foundation type, and accessibility. For example, difficult-to-reach foundations may increase the overall expense.
Average Cost Breakdown - Foundation jacking services generally charge between $10 and $30 per square foot. Smaller homes or structures may cost less, while commercial or large residential projects may be more expensive.
Additional Expenses - Costs for permits, inspections, and site preparation can add to the total. It’s advisable to cont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to specific project need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
